COP26: Pledge to cut methane emissions

The COP26 conference has seen leaders pledge to cut methane gas emissions to reduce the impact of climate change.

The Global Methane Pledge saw over 100 countries commit to cutting methane emissions by 30% by 2030 from 2020 levels. The signatories cover almost 50% of global methane emissions which are believed to account for 30% of global warming. Signatories include Brazil, one of the top five methane emitters, although China, Russia and India have not signed. The US has outlined a proposal to reduce its emissions in the oil and gas sector from flaring and infrastructure leaks.
